Senior Occupancy Planner – JLL
About This Role
As an Occupancy Planner, you will serve as a strategic partner in optimizing our client's real estate portfolio through data-driven space planning and occupancy management. You'll act as a critical bridge between stakeholders, coordinating seamlessly across local teams, the client's Corporate Real Estate (CRE) group, and internal JLL functions to deliver intelligent workspace solutions.
Your focus will center on portfolio optimization and space maximization, leveraging both qualitative insights and quantitative analytics to balance supply with demand. Core responsibilities include maintaining space data integrity, leading the space audit program, and producing actionable portfolio intelligence.

Key Responsibilities
Data Management & Reporting
- Deliver monthly space utilization reports and maintain current space data across the portfolio
- Manage and validate site audit processes to ensure data accuracy
- Monitor utilization patterns and trends, providing insights that inform strategic decisions
- Maintain CAFM system accuracy including space allocations, neighborhood configurations, and employee assignments
